Okay, here’s the story. My wife and I started flipping antiques a few years ago. We have had some random success but never really found a niche. A few month back I saw someone selling egg cups on a marketplace and was amazed that they were asking for $20 for a set. I messaged them out of curiosity and saw that they were already pending pick up.
Fast forward to yesterday when I saw a Facebook post from a lady selling her moms collection. Story is that he mom was an avid egg cup collector for 40+ years and had collected over 1500 of them. I sent her a message and went for a visit. There are egg cups from around the world, many of which are pretty old. I asked a bunch of questions about the collection and was upfront about my plans. I purchased the entire collection for $350. Now we plan to clean, categorize, photograph, post and hopefully sell. I think we seriously under estimated how much work this will be. It took three people nearly five hours to wrap and package everything. In addition to the photos, there was also multiple boxes of eggs that were already packaged and never put on display.
Wish us luck!
Edit: I would also like to add that it was a true honour and pleasure to package these cups with the seller and to be able to listen to the stories and adventures that her mom had. This collection is more than just egg cups. They are a family legacy and they will continue to play a role in the lives of her loved ones. The seller mentioned that at the celebration of life, family and friends each took their favourite and most memorable egg cups. The rest of the collection was posted for sale.
